| The submarine receives all around the world attention of navy because of its fine tactical performance, good disguise, stronger self-sufficiency strength, endurance and greater assault strength. However, because the submarine has smaller reserve buoyancy, large activity in depth, complex equipments, vertically and horizontally pipelines, hard maintain, higher requirement of submerged control and equilibrium and so on, accidents of the submarine wreck always take place. How to rescue wreck submarine is a big problem that always puzzles every country's submarine force.Collective escape compartment which is a kind of unaided equipment unit can effectively improve submariners' abilities to save themselves, assure submariners' security at the process of escaping danger, so it excels any kind of escaping system.This paper mainly has studyed the technique of connecting submarine and collective escape compartment. The technique of the collective escape compartment's installation and release is one of the key techniques of the collective escape compartment research. The collective escape compartment must be assembled on submarine by definite contact form which will guarantee the secure of collective escape compartment regular location, will again guarantee the flexibility that released when using and will still guarantee the leakproofness of trunks at the commissure. The equipment must ensure that the collective escape compartment be released safely at any location and any pose no matter by its buoyancy or by any other manners, such as system of emergency release.First, this paper has analysed the advantages and the shortcomings of junction device in existence. Then this paper has designed new shape of connection on the base of existed techniques and submarine accident analysis. Comparing of the existed junction device, this paper has added skirt, converted the position of encapsulation, defined the carrelation parameter of internal gearing by caculating, determined the sizes of butt joint referencing the existedjunction device and adopted finite element analysis software to check the strength of structure component.At the same time, this paper has added emergency starting arrangement. Even trim ±30° or heel ±45° , this equipment can make sure the collective escape compartment to be released safely. High pressure air has be adopted as working midium of the emergency starting arrangement, because of air pressure gearing having many advantages, such as its arrangement being not restricted by space position and good operational environment adaptability etc. According to analyzing the forces the collective escape compartment accepted and combining restriction coming from space, we have chosen high pressure air cylinder to be the source of air pressure gearing and have designed the dimension of cylinder.At the end of the paper, we have proofed the security of releasing the collective escape compartment from the point of theoretical analysis when the submarine trims ±30° or heels ±45° . The result indicates that our project have strong practicability. |
